How Did Barbiecore Aesthetic Start

Barbiecore as we know it had its start with the ascent of early 2000s celebrity fashion icons like Paris Hilton, Nicole Richie, and Britney Spears. Their attire was extremely feminine, frequently pink or glittering, and neatly covered in pearls.

Pop musicians played a big part in accelerating the trend in the late aughts, starting with Ariana Grande’s excessively feminine look, which has Barbie to thank. Through an alter persona known as “the Harajuku Barbie,” Nicki Minaj has been channeling the doll since 2010. She uses allusions to the doll in her lyrics, song names, and album art, as well as donning a pink wig and a necklace with the Barbie insignia.

Barbiecore has lately been a popular fashion trend, thanks to the Barbie film’s return. Barbiecore will undoubtedly be a mainstay of this summer with her pink platform heels and pink plastic handbags.

Barbiecore and How It Empowered Women

We can totally perceive Barbiecore as a less sexualized aesthetic of Bimbocore. Throughout the history of the fashion industry and feminism, the rise of Barbiecore has empowered women who want to express themselves without fearing judgment. 

Since the 90s, women were praised for their physical faculties, rather than mental faculties, especially those who were blonde. Fast forward to the 2000s, around this time, women seemed to suppress their femininity as femininity was associated with weakness and a lack of intelligence. These are the toxic stereotypes that the media was spreading about femininity, making young girls refuse to embrace girly interests. Overall, the “Bimbo” paradox made women police their behavior and appearance to not be seen as too “Ditzy”, denying themselves the pleasure of being girly and wearing pink.

People started to feel nostalgic, wanting to revisit those y2k, 2000s memories of them when hyper-femininity was everywhere as the lockdown hit. Thanks to those factors, the y2k aesthetic, which consisted of Barbiecore, Bimbocore, and Mcbling was popular again. The comeback of those fashion trends allowed women to express themselves through feminine clothes without being sexualized and associated with unintelligence. This simple yet significant movement helped many women to embrace their femininity, break the harmful stereotypes of feminine women.

2000s Iconic, Popular Celebrities Outfits

Many celebrities were known for their iconic Y2K fashion looks in the early 2000s. Here are a few of the most famous ones:

Britney Spears: Britney Spears was the ultimate Y2K fashion icon as well as the queen of Pop. She was known for her crop tops, low-rise jeans, chunky sneakers and playful accessories like butterfly hair clips and belly chains. 

Paris Hilton: Paris Hilton was another influential Y2K fashion symbol. Paris Hilton is the definition of Y2K. Velour tracksuits, hot pink crop tops and her iconic 21st birthday outfit are what make her so representative of the 2000s

Christina Aguilera: Christina Aguilera’s classified as the twentieth most successful artist of the 2000s by Billboard. She is famous for her confident and daring style. She often wore bold prints, neon colors, and provocative outfits like chaps and corsets.

Justin Timberlake: Justin Timberlake’s Y2K style was all about being cool and laid-back. He often wore baggy cargo pants, oversized graphic tees, and bucket hats. If you’re a guy and struggling with finding 2000s clothes, just search “Justin Timberlake in the 2000s”, there will be hundreds of inspirations for you.

Destiny’s Child: The members of Destiny’s Child, Beyoncé, Kelly Rowland, and Michelle Williams, were known for their coordinated outfits and fierce fashion choices. They often wore matching sets, colorful ensembles, and bold accessories.
